Sidewalk construction services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of concrete walkways that provide safe and accessible paths across residential and commercial properties. These services typically include site preparation, grading, pouring, and finishing the concrete to create smooth, durable surfaces. Skilled contractors ensure the sidewalks are level and properly sloped for drainage, helping to improve the overall functionality and appearance of a property. Whether building new walkways or restoring existing ones, these services are essential for creating safe outdoor spaces that enhance curb appeal and accessibility.

The overview below groups typical Sidewalk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Antonio,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or sidewalk repairs in San Antonio range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as filling cracks or minor leveling,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ach the higher end, which is usually reserved for more extensive patchwork.
Full Replacement - Complete sidewalk replacement in the area often costs between $3,000 and $6,000. Larger, more complex projects, such as replacing multiple sections or installing new sidewalks, can exceed $7,000 depending on scope and materials.
Pattern and Decorative Work - Custom designs or decorative concrete sidewalks typically cost $4,000 to $8,000. These projects are less common and tend to be on the higher end due to additional labor and materials involved.
Large-Scale Projects - Extensive sidewalk installation or reconstruction for commercial properties can range from $10,000 to $20,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ent and depend heavily on size, site conditions, and design compl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of sidewalks do local contractors typically build? Local contractors in San Antonio can construct various types of sidewalks, including concrete, brick, and stamped designs, to match different styles and functional needs.
How do local service providers prepare the site for sidewalk construction? They typically clear the area, ensure proper grading, and set a stable base to ensure the sidewalk is level and durable.
Can local contractors handle repairs for existing sidewalks? Yes, many local service providers offer repair services such as crack filling, leveling, and replacing damaged sections of existing sidewalks.
What materials are commonly used by local pros for sidewalk installation? Common materials include concrete, brick, pavers, and sometimes stamped or stained finishes for aesthetic appeal.
How do local contractors ensure proper drainage around sidewalks? They design the sidewalk with appropriate slope and grading to promote water runoff and prevent pooling or water damage.
